- <abstract abstract-type="main" id="tht3162-abs-0001"> <title> <x xml:space="preserve">Abstract</x> </title> <p id="tht3162-para-0001">The idea of relevant logic—that irrelevant inferences are invalid—is appealing. But the standard semantics for relevant logics involve baroque metaphysics: a three‐place accessibility relation, a star operator, and 'bad' (impossible/non‐normal) worlds. In this article we propose that these oddities express a mismatch between non‐classical object theory and classical metatheory. A uniformly relevant semantics for relevant logic is a better fit.</p> </abstract>
